When you're researching universities, keep a few things in mind, like the university's accreditation, the course curriculum, the faculty expertise, and the support services available to online students. Accreditation ensures that the program meets certain quality standards, and it's a key factor in recognizing the value of your degree. Check the university's accreditation from UGC or AICTE. The curriculum should align with your interests and career goals. Look for a program that covers core physics topics like mechanics, electromagnetism, thermodynamics, and quantum mechanics, along with specialized courses that pique your interest. The faculty should be experienced and knowledgeable in the field of physics. Look for universities with professors who have strong academic backgrounds and research experience. And finally, consider the support services available to online students, such as online libraries, career counseling, and technical support.

Course Curriculum and What to Expect
So, what exactly will you be studying in an online BSc Physics program? The curriculum typically covers a wide range of topics, providing a solid foundation in physics principles. Expect to dive into core subjects like mechanics, electromagnetism, thermodynamics, optics, and quantum mechanics. These form the bedrock of any physics degree. You'll learn about the fundamental laws that govern the universe and develop the skills to solve complex problems. Don't worry, even online, you'll still get to play with the cool stuff!
Besides the core topics, you can also expect to explore specialized areas depending on the program. Some programs may offer courses in astrophysics, nuclear physics, materials science, or electronics. These electives allow you to tailor your degree to your interests and career aspirations. Think of it as a chance to get a sneak peek into the specific areas of physics that excite you the most. You might discover a passion for something you never even knew existed! In addition to theoretical coursework, online programs often incorporate practical components. These might include virtual labs, simulations, and projects that allow you to apply your knowledge and develop your problem-solving skills. Don't worry, you'll still get hands-on experience, even if you're not in a physical lab. Technology has made it possible to conduct virtual experiments and analyze data. Online BSc Physics programs utilize various teaching methods to deliver the curriculum. You'll likely encounter pre-recorded lectures, live online sessions, interactive simulations, and virtual lab experiences. Online lectures provide the flexibility to learn at your own pace. Live sessions offer opportunities to interact with professors and classmates in real-time. Interactive simulations bring physics concepts to life, allowing you to visualize and experiment with complex phenomena. Virtual labs provide hands-on experience, allowing you to conduct experiments and analyze data without being physically present in a lab. All these resources are designed to provide a comprehensive and engaging learning experience. The course usually takes 3 to 4 years to complete, depending on the university and program structure. The course duration may vary. The semester system is used in most universities.
Career Opportunities with an Online BSc Physics Degree
Okay, so you've got your degree. Now what? The good news is that an online BSc Physics degree opens up a world of exciting career opportunities. Physics graduates are highly sought after in various industries due to their strong analytical and problem-solving skills. Let's explore some of the career paths you can take with your degree. One popular option is to pursue a career in research. Physicists are always in demand for research roles in universities, government labs, and private companies. You could be involved in groundbreaking research in areas like cosmology, particle physics, or materials science. It's a chance to push the boundaries of knowledge and make discoveries that could change the world. You could also work in the engineering field. Physics graduates often apply their knowledge to solve engineering problems in areas like electronics, aerospace, and renewable energy. The analytical skills you gain in physics are invaluable in these fields. Engineering roles can offer opportunities to design, develop, and test new technologies. If you love math, you can consider a career in data science. Data scientists are in high demand across many industries. Your strong analytical skills and mathematical background make you a great fit for data science roles. You can analyze data, build models, and provide insights that help companies make informed decisions. It's a rapidly growing field with tons of opportunities. The teaching profession is also an option. If you're passionate about sharing your knowledge, you can become a physics teacher or professor. You can inspire the next generation of scientists and engineers. Being a teacher is a fulfilling career that allows you to make a real difference in the lives of others.
Also, you could venture into the software development industry. Physicists are well-equipped to handle complex programming tasks. With your understanding of algorithms and mathematical concepts, you can excel in software development roles. You could work on developing software applications, designing algorithms, or building new technologies. Finally, let's look at the financial sector. Physics graduates are often hired in the financial sector for their analytical and quantitative skills. You could work as a financial analyst, risk analyst, or quantitative analyst. Your problem-solving skills are perfect for analyzing financial data and making informed investment decisions. Other roles include: medical physicist, meteorologist, astronomer, and more.
Admission Requirements and Process
So, how do you get started? The admission requirements for an online BSc Physics degree typically include the following. You'll usually need to have completed your 10+2 (or equivalent) with science subjects, including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ics. The specific requirements can vary from university to university, so check the admission criteria of your chosen program. You'll also need to meet the minimum percentage or grade point average set by the university. Universities may also conduct entrance exams or interviews to assess your suitability for the program. Check to see if this is needed. Admission processes may also involve submitting an application form, providing academic transcripts, and paying an application fee. These processes will vary across different universities, so make sure to check each individual university for details. So, get all your paperwork together, do your research, and apply!
